Knowledge Management and Learning (KML) Specialist:
ICF International is seeking a Knowledge Management and Learning Specialist (KML) for a USAID funded project in the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C). The KML Specialist must be familiar with knowledge management practices and their applications within a national-level development portfolio. The Senior Monitoring Specialist shall work closely with USAID/ DRC Program Office, M&E team, and development objective teams and with USAID implementing partners.
Job Description:
- The KML Specialist will be responsible for facilitating the practical application of knowledge resulting from monitoring and evaluations (M&E) and learning activities at USAID/DRC as well as other sources.
- The KML Specialist must be familiar with knowledge management practices and their applications within a national-level development portfolio. The KML Specialist will be the lead Collaborating, Learning, and Adapting (CLA) functions of the M&E project.
- The KML Specialist should be knowledgeable of and comfortable working within knowledge management (KM) systems and understand the limits and potential of these systems and their ability to contribute to the knowledge of development programs in the context of DRC.
- Experience conducting and/or organizing workshops / seminars frequently and on a variety of development topics.
Qualifications:
- A Masters (or higher) degree in the field of international relations, economics, political science, public policy, statistics, and/or other relevant field.
- At least 8 years of progressively more responsible experience in the M&E systems, learning approaches, workshop facilitation, and technical assistance
- Experience using performance monitoring data for the improvement of ongoing project/activity management.
- Experience in the gender dimensions.
- Familiarity with USG policies, related to performance monitoring.
Professional Skills:
- Demonstrated excellent writing and presentation ability, as well as experience successfully leading an intercultural team in a development context.
- Excellent analytical skills
- Fluency in French and English
